Understanding Satellite Internet Speeds
Satellite internet speeds can be affected by various factors that users may not always be aware of. Understanding these factors is crucial in troubleshooting speed drops effectively. Here are some key aspects to consider:
- Factors Affecting Satellite Internet Speeds
Satellite internet speeds can be impacted by several factors, including the user’s location, the positioning of the satellite dish, and the quality of the satellite signal. Additionally, the type of satellite internet service being used, such as geostationary or low-earth orbit satellites, can also affect speeds.
- Bandwidth Limitations
Satellite internet providers often have bandwidth limitations in place to ensure fair usage among all subscribers. Exceeding these limitations can result in reduced speeds as the provider may throttle the connection speed for heavy users during peak times.
- Weather Interference
Weather conditions, such as heavy rain, snow, or strong winds, can interfere with the satellite signal, leading to a drop in internet speeds. This is because the satellite dish needs a clear line of sight to the satellite in orbit, and adverse weather can disrupt this connection.
- Network Congestion
Network congestion occurs when multiple users in the same area are trying to access the internet simultaneously, putting a strain on the satellite’s capacity. This congestion can lead to slower speeds for all users sharing the same satellite beam, especially during peak usage hours.

Checking for Weather Interference
l Troubleshooting Steps
Satellite internet can be particularly susceptible to weather conditions, which can significantly impact your internet speed. It’s crucial to understand how weather interference affects your satellite connection and take appropriate steps to address these issues promptly.
How weather conditions impact satellite internet
-
Rain: Heavy rain can absorb satellite signals, leading to signal loss and reduced internet speeds. The intensity of the rain and its duration can directly correlate with the impact on your connection.
-
Snow: Similar to rain, snow can obstruct the satellite signal path, causing interference and affecting the quality of your internet connection. Accumulation of snow on the satellite dish can exacerbate this issue.
-
Storms: Severe weather events like thunderstorms can disrupt satellite signals, leading to intermittent connection drops and slower speeds. Lightning strikes near the satellite dish can also damage the equipment.

Aligning the Satellite Dish Properly
Proper alignment of the satellite dish is crucial to ensure optimal internet speeds are maintained. Even a slight misalignment can lead to signal degradation and a drop in speed. To align the satellite dish correctly, follow these steps:
-
Importance of correct alignment for optimal speeds: When the satellite dish is accurately aligned with the satellite in orbit, it can receive and transmit data efficiently. Misalignment can result in signal interference, leading to slower speeds and potential connectivity issues.
-
Tools needed for adjusting dish alignment: To align the satellite dish properly, you will typically need a satellite signal meter, a wrench or screwdriver for adjustments, and possibly a compass to determine the correct azimuth and elevation angles. The satellite signal meter helps in fine-tuning the alignment by providing real-time feedback on signal strength as adjustments are made to the dish position.

Data-Saving Techniques
Optimizing Satellite Internet Performance
Satellite internet users often face challenges with speed drops, which can be frustrating. However, there are effective data-saving techniques that can help optimize your satellite internet performance. Implementing these strategies can make a significant difference in maintaining a more consistent and satisfactory internet speed.
-
Enabling Data Compression:
- Data compression is a valuable technique that can help reduce the amount of data transmitted over your satellite connection. By enabling data compression, files and web pages can be compressed before being sent to your device, resulting in faster loading times and decreased data usage. This can be particularly beneficial for activities such as browsing the web and accessing emails.
-
Restricting Background Data Usage:
- Background data usage refers to applications and services that consume data even when you are not actively using them. By restricting background data usage on your devices, you can prevent unnecessary data consumption that may be affecting your satellite internet speed. This can typically be done through the settings menu on most devices, allowing you to select which apps are allowed to use data in the background.
-
Limiting Video Streaming Quality:
- Video streaming is a data-intensive activity that can quickly consume significant amounts of bandwidth. To help prevent speed drops on your satellite internet connection, consider limiting the quality of the videos you stream. Many streaming services offer options to adjust the video quality, allowing you to reduce the resolution and conserve data. By opting for lower quality settings, you can enjoy smoother playback while minimizing the impact on your internet speed.
